A chiller is a versatile cooling system used in various industrial, commercial, and residential applications to remove heat from liquids and maintain optimal temperatures in processes, equipment, or environments. Chillers are critical in settings where precise temperature control is essential for the efficiency, safety, and quality of operations.

Key Uses of a Chiller

1. Industrial Process Cooling

  • Maintaining Optimal Temperatures: In industries like plastics, pharmaceuticals, and chemicals, chillers are used to maintain the required temperature for manufacturing processes. For example, in plastic manufacturing, a Mold Temperature Controller works in conjunction with a chiller to keep the molds at precise temperatures, ensuring high-quality production and preventing defects.
  • Cooling Machinery and Equipment: Chillers are used to cool machinery, such as in metalworking, where they prevent overheating of equipment and maintain the integrity of processes.

2. HVAC Systems in Commercial Buildings

  • Climate Control: Chillers are a crucial part of HVAC (Heating, Ventilation, and Air Conditioning) systems in large commercial buildings like offices, hospitals, and shopping malls. They provide cooled water or air that circulates through the building to maintain comfortable indoor temperatures. Systems like Air-Cooled Water Chillers and Water Cooled Water Chillers are commonly used in such settings to ensure a stable and controlled environment.

3. Food and Beverage Industry

  • Preserving Quality and Safety: Chillers are used to cool products during various stages of production, storage, and transportation in the food and beverage industry. For instance, in breweries, chillers maintain the correct fermentation temperatures, which is vital for producing high-quality beer.

4. Medical and Laboratory Applications

  • Temperature-Sensitive Equipment: In medical facilities and laboratories, chillers are used to cool sensitive equipment like MRI machines, CT scanners, and laser systems. They ensure that these devices operate within safe temperature ranges, preventing overheating and potential damage.
  • Cold Storage: Chillers are also used in cold storage solutions to preserve biological samples, medications, and other temperature-sensitive materials.

5. Data Centers and IT Facilities

  • Cooling Servers and Equipment: Data centers rely on chillers to remove the heat generated by servers and other IT equipment. Maintaining an optimal temperature is crucial to prevent overheating, which can lead to equipment failure and data loss. Systems like Water Cooled Screw Chillers are often used in such environments for their efficiency and reliability.

6. Support for Auxiliary Systems

  • Integration with Other Systems: Chillers often work alongside auxiliary equipment such as Hot Air Dryers, Vacuum Hopper Loaders, and Dehumidifiers to create a controlled environment for various industrial processes. This integration ensures that all systems operate efficiently and within the required temperature parameters.
